IndiGo’s Neetan Chopra calls agentic AI, blockchain, and stable coins a “lethal potentiality for the future,” but says businesses aren’t there yet.
In a conversation with MIT Sloan Management Review India, the Chief Digital and Information Officer at IndiGo shared how the airline is preparing for autonomous enterprises, scaling AI through Lab 37, and embedding a true digital mindset beyond the clichés of “digital transformation.”
